Abstract

An extensive survey was conducted to assess the frequency and abundance of plant-parasitic nematodes associated with cotton (Gossypium hirsutum L.) in Haryana (Nuh and Palwal districts) during 2018-20. Based on incidence, population density and associated damage on affected crops, root-knot nematode (Meloidogyne incognita) was considered to be the most important parasite of the crops under local condition. During 2018-19, a total of 11 soil and root samples of cotton were collected from Nuh and Palwal districts. Out of these, eight were found infected with M. incognita with 72.0% frequency of occurrence. The results revealed that out of 7 samples (Nuh), five were found infested with M. incognita with 71.4% frequency of occurrence. In Palwal district, this nematode had 75.0% frequency of occurrence with density range of 60-300 j2 200-1 cc soil. During 2019-20, a total of 27 soil and root samples of cotton were collected from Nuh and Palwal districts. Out of these, 14 were found infected with M. incognita with 51.8% frequency of occurrence. The results revealed that out of 21 samples (Nuh), 12 were found infested with M. incognita with 57.1% frequency of occurrence and density range of 95-690 j2 200-1 cc soil. In Palwal district, this nematode had 33.3% frequency of occurrence (2 out of 6 samples) with density range of 135-435 j2 200-1 cc soil. Other plant parasitic nematodes which were found associated with the cotton belonged to Rotylenchulus reniformis, Hoplolaimus sp., Helicotylenchus sp. and Tylenchorhynchus sp.
